## Break-Glass: Trace Access (Plugin Authors)

If your Gladwick plugin loses trace context across microservice hops, do not mint new trace IDs. File a break-glass request with the Relayline team; emergency read access to the span store is granted for 30 minutes. Propagate the `gw-trace` header verbatim. To unlock the emergency tracing console, use the passphrase below.

vault phrase of bagaf-kajeg = jorath-feniel-briir-siliel-ralix

**Ticket MAIL-417: Donation-receipt mailer leaks internal headers**

The Greenbriar donation-receipt mailer includes internal routing headers in outbound mail. No donor data exposed, but headers reveal staging hostnames. Needs security review before the Thursday release. Fix strips headers at the relay step; patch is in review. The candidate build token for verification is below.

trace token, fafog-kageg: htk4_98e6

Welcome to the LeafTimer release process. Before cutting a build of the plant-watering scheduler, verify the environment file carefully: timezone, pump-controller endpoint, and retry limits must match the release sheet exactly. Once those are confirmed, there is exactly one credential to set. Add the line granting the scheduler access to the pump gateway immediately below:

vault entry, bagep-yahip: VAULT_KEY8=d2a227e5

## Onboarding: Plotnik Address Autocomplete Widget

Welcome to the Plotnik team. The widget lives in the `plotnik-ui` repo and calls the Gazetteer suggestion service. Local development uses a mocked suggestion index, so you don't need production data to start. To run the end-to-end suite, however, you must decrypt the staging geodata bundle once per machine. The decryption tool will prompt you for the recovery passphrase below.

strongbox words: zorwyn-sorael-belion-ulaius-silmir-ulays-briax-rusdor-gorix

Action item from the Mirewater tide-table widget incident. Owner: release manager. Widget cached stale harbor offsets after the DST change, showing tides six hours off for two days. Required: add a cache-invalidation check to the release checklist, block deploys when offset tables are older than 24 hours, and verify the Saltgate harbor feed before each cut. Deadline: next release. Checklist template and sign-off procedure are documented on the internal page below.

wiki page, kawif-bajep: https://artifactory.zarqelforge.internal/issue/browse/display/display/projects/spaces/secrets/000fe6ec5a46af29355003e1